About Abnormal Security:

Abnormal Security is defining the next generation of email and identity security defense. Our platform uses machine learning and artificial intelligence to baseline communication content, user identity, and behavioral signals in real-time and at-scale in order to detect the abnormalities of email attacks.

 

Customers love us because we consistently detect and stop what everyone else in the market can’t -- advanced attacks that have never been seen before -- and we do so with beautiful user interfaces and best-in-industry customer support.

 

Our veteran team has built some of the most enduring machine learning platforms at leading companies including Proofpoint,  Google, Twitter, Pinterest, Amazon, and Microsoft. Our headquarters are in San Francisco with offices in Utah and New York.

 Position Overview

Abnormal Security is seeking a highly motivated sales leader to join our Field Sales organization as a Regional Director for the Western Region.  This sales leader will be responsible for all elements of team development – recruitment, hiring, enablement, and management of a sales team, as well as driving revenue growth and exceeding sales targets within the Western Region.

The Regional Director will need to be passionate about the extraordinary value Abnormal is providing to our customers and conduct themselves with exceptional professionalism, honesty, and integrity.

 Typical duties & responsibilities (but not limited to):

  • Recruit and hire a world class team of enterprise sellers, on time and on budget
  • Clearly articulate, manage and enable enterprise seller to hit all key productivity metrics and milestones of growth 
  • Instill a disciplined approach to pipeline generation leveraging all available resources including field sales, marketing, channel partners, and sales development to accelerate new business.
  • Develop an overall account strategy for the region resulting in strong execution and collaborative team selling.
  • Partner closely with Sales Engineering to deliver outstanding product demonstrations and a repeatable technology validation / proof-of-concept program.
  • Build a strong partnership with existing customers that focuses on value realization and customer retention delivered through high renewal rates, rapid upsell expansion, and customer referrals.
  • Effectively forecast monthly/ quarterly revenue to executive leadership through disciplined deal inspection and forecast methodology.
  • Develop strategic relationships with existing channel partners and the development of new channel partners.
  • Facilitate Quarterly Business Reviews to measure sales productivity, plan execution, and progress against strategic objectives.
  • Identify, cultivate, and close new business at executive levels (CISO/CIO/CTO) in enterprise accounts within the designated territory.
